GHSA-jm8c-9f3j-4378: pretalx mail templates vulnerable to email injection via unescaped user-controlled placeholders

April 18, 2026

An unauthenticated attacker can send arbitrary HTML-rendered emails from a pretalx instance’s configured sender address by embedding malformed HTML or markdown link syntax in a user-controlled template placeholder such as the account display name. The most direct vector is the password-reset flow: the attacker registers an account with a malicious name, enters the victim’s email address, and triggers a password reset. The resulting email is delivered from the event’s legitimate sender address and passes SPF/DKIM/DMARC validation, making it a ready-made phishing vector.

The same class of bug affects every mail template that interpolates a user-controlled placeholder (speaker name, proposal title, biography, question answers, etc.), including organiser-triggered emails such as acceptance/rejection notifications.

Affected versions

All versions before 2026.1.0

Fixed versions

  • 2026.1.0

Solution

Upgrade to version 2026.1.0 or above.

Impact 6.1 MEDIUM

C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:C/C:L/I:L/A:N

Learn more about CVSS

Weakness

  • CWE-116: Improper Encoding or Escaping of Output
  • CWE-79: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ation ('Cross-site Scripting')
